@upendradevsingh/webcore
Version:
UI Core Components for web
50 lines (38 loc) • 1.25 kB
JavaScript
;
var _react = require('react');
var _react2 = _interopRequireDefault(_react);
var _reactAddonsCreateFragment = require('react-addons-create-fragment');
var _chai = require('chai');
var _enzyme = require('enzyme');
var _Modal = require('../Modal');
var _Modal2 = _interopRequireDefault(_Modal);
function _interopRequireDefault(obj) { return obj && obj.__esModule ? obj : { default: obj }; }
var wrapper = (0, _enzyme.render)(_react2.default.createElement(
_Modal2.default,
{
header: true,
footer: true,
customBodyClass: '',
title: 'Modal Title',
dataContent: {
"data": {
"name": "yogendra"
},
"headers": {},
"method": "GET"
},
optionType: 'link',
dataUrl: 'https://jsonplaceholder.typicode.com/users',
dialogLinkContent: 'Open Me',
dataTarget: '' },
' ',
"Initial Content"
));
describe("<Modal />", function () {
it("should render children when supplied", function () {
(0, _chai.expect)(wrapper).to.have.length(1);
});
it("should return the props when supplied", function () {
(0, _chai.expect)(wrapper).to.have.length(1);
});
});